The Global Demand for Uniforms

With rising safety standards and a focus on corporate branding, the global demand for uniforms has seen exponential growth in recent years. Multifunctional uniforms are now being embraced not only for their practical benefits but also as part of a company’s branding strategy. As countries emerge from the economic impact of the pandemic, businesses are keen to restore their image through professional attire.

Germany’s reputation for engineering excellence translates into high-quality garment production, making it an ideal candidate to meet rising global demand. Companies across different sectors strive for uniforms that offer durability, comfort, and brand cohesion, enabling a strong entry point for German manufacturers.

Key Sectors Driving Uniform Exports

Several sectors are pivotal in driving uniform exports from Germany. Below are some of the most promising areas:

  • Healthcare: With the ongoing demand for healthcare professionals, hospitals and clinics are looking for high-quality and functional uniforms. Enhanced hygiene features and comfort have become essential criteria in choosing uniforms for healthcare workers.
  • Hospitality: Restaurants and hotels focus on uniforms that reflect their brand image while offering comfort and practicality to their staff. As the hospitality industry rebounds, there is a necessity for modern, stylish staff uniforms.
  • Corporate: Businesses are keen to present a professional image to clients and customers. Uniforms that reflect a company’s branding can enhance recognition and loyalty.

Challenges in the Uniform Export Market

Despite the favorable market conditions, German manufacturers face several challenges in exporting uniforms. Compliance with multiple regulations across different countries can hinder the ease of exporting goods. Moreover, competition from lower-cost countries can threaten profit margins. Therefore, German companies must focus on their unique selling propositions: quality, sustainability, and craftsmanship.

Future Trends in Uniform Exports

The future for uniform exports looks promising as businesses increasingly invest in employee comfort and branding through clothing. Key trends shaping this market include:

  • Sustainability: Manufacturers are being urged to adopt eco-friendly materials and processes in response to the global push for sustainability.
  • Technological Integration: Advanced textile technology, such as moisture-wicking and durable fabrics, is becoming more prevalent in uniform production.
  • Customization: Businesses are leaning towards tailored uniforms that reflect their organizational culture, emphasizing the need for flexibility in production.
